Minister: Construction of 15,845 'Red and White' Village Cooperatives Completed
Jakarta (ANTARA) - Cooperatives Minister Ferry Juliantono announced that the construction of 15,845 ‘Red and White’ Village/Sub-district Cooperatives (KDMP) has been fully completed, encompassing physical buildings, warehouses, retail outlets, and their supporting equipment. Speaking at the peak celebration of the 79th Cooperatives Day at the Indonesia Arena GBK, Jakarta, on Sunday, the minister stated that legal deeds for 83,000 KDMP entities have also been finalised. He noted that a further 19,539 KDMP are currently under construction, out of a total of approximately 35,000 planned units. The government is preparing to deploy trained managers to the completed cooperatives, with their training scheduled to conclude in early August 2026. The Minister requested President Prabowo Subianto to officially inaugurate the operations of the cooperatives, which is planned for August 2026. The government is targeting 40,000 operational KDMP by the end of 2026 as part of efforts to strengthen the village economy. Deputy Minister Farida Farichah added that the focus is not only on completing physical infrastructure but also on preparing human resources to manage the cooperatives professionally, with manager training taking place from 17 to 31 July 2026.
